13 Festive Christmas Casserole Recipes That Feed a Crowd


Pin This Now to Remember It Later
Pin This

Gathering for the holidays means sharing meals that warm the heart and fill the belly. Casseroles are the ultimate comfort food, perfect for large gatherings, and they make serving a crowd feel effortless. From creamy and cheesy to savory and hearty, these festive Christmas casserole recipes bring a touch of cheer to your holiday table. Let’s dive into these crowd-pleasing dishes!

1. Cheesy Potato Casserole

A creamy delight that’s sure to please.

Ingredients:

  • 4 cups diced potatoes
  • 1 cup shredded cheddar cheese
  • 1 cup sour cream
  • 1 can cream of mushroom soup
  • ½ cup diced onions
  • Salt and pepper to taste

Process:

  1. Preheat oven to 350°F (175°C).
  2. In a bowl, mix all ingredients and transfer to a baking dish.
  3. Bake for 45 minutes until golden and bubbly.

Make it Unique:
Add crumbled bacon or replace cheddar with Swiss cheese for a different flavor.

2. Holiday Veggie Casserole

A garden of flavors in one dish.

Ingredients:

  • 2 cups mixed vegetables (broccoli, carrots, bell peppers)
  • 1 cup cream of chicken soup
  • 1 cup shredded mozzarella cheese
  • 1 cup breadcrumbs
  • 1 tablespoon olive oil
  • Salt and pepper to taste

Process:

  1. Preheat oven to 375°F (190°C).
  2. Combine vegetables, soup, and half the cheese; place in a greased baking dish.
  3. Top with breadcrumbs and remaining cheese; bake for 30 minutes.

Make it Unique:
Mix in quinoa or top with parmesan for added crunch.

3. Sausage and Egg Breakfast Casserole

A delicious way to kick off your holiday mornings.

Ingredients:

  • 1 pound breakfast sausage
  • 6 eggs
  • 2 cups milk
  • 1 cup shredded cheddar cheese
  • 6 slices of bread, cubed
  • Salt and pepper to taste

Process:

  1. Brown sausage in a pan; drain fat.
  2. Whisk eggs and milk, then mix with sausage, bread, and cheese; pour into a greased dish.
  3. Bake at 350°F (175°C) for 45 minutes.

Make it Unique:
Add spinach for extra nutrition or swap sausage for bacon.

4. Sweet Potato Casserole

Sweetness that sings of the season.

Ingredients:

  • 4 cups mashed sweet potatoes
  • 1 cup brown sugar
  • ½ cup butter, melted
  • 2 eggs
  • 1 teaspoon vanilla extract
  • 2 cups mini marshmallows

Process:

  1. Preheat oven to 350°F (175°C).
  2. Mix all ingredients (reserve marshmallows) and pour into a baking dish.
  3. Top with marshmallows; bake for 25 minutes until marshmallows are golden.

Make it Unique:
Add crushed pecans on top or swap brown sugar with maple syrup.

5. Chicken and Rice Casserole

A scrumptious classic for the whole family.

Ingredients:

  • 2 cups cooked rice
  • 2 cups shredded rotisserie chicken
  • 1 can cream of chicken soup
  • 1 cup chicken broth
  • 1 cup frozen peas
  • 1 cup crispy fried onions

Process:

  1. Preheat oven to 350°F (175°C).
  2. Combine all ingredients in a baking dish, except for half of the onions.
  3. Bake for 30 minutes, then add remaining onions and bake for an additional 10 minutes.

Make it Unique:
Add your favorite vegetables or swap chicken for turkey.

6. Beef Stroganoff Casserole

Rich, creamy, and oh-so-satisfying.

Ingredients:

  • 1 pound ground beef
  • 1 onion, chopped
  • 2 cups egg noodles, cooked
  • 1 can cream of mushroom soup
  • 1 cup sour cream
  • Salt and pepper to taste

Process:

  1. Cook beef and onion in a pan; drain grease.
  2. Stir in noodles, soup, and sour cream; transfer to a baking dish.
  3. Bake at 350°F (175°C) for 25 minutes.

Make it Unique:
Use ground turkey or add mushrooms for an extra flavor punch.

7. Spinach and Feta Casserole

A delightful vegetarian option bursting with flavor.

Ingredients:

  • 4 cups fresh spinach
  • 1 cup crumbled feta cheese
  • 1 cup ricotta cheese
  • 2 eggs
  • 1 cup breadcrumbs
  • Salt and pepper to taste

Process:

Pin This Now to Remember It Later
Pin This

  1. Preheat oven to 375°F (190°C).
  2. Mix spinach, cheeses, eggs, and seasonings; place in a greased dish.
  3. Top with breadcrumbs; bake for 30 minutes.

Make it Unique:
Add sun-dried tomatoes or swap feta for goat cheese.

8. Turkey Tetrazzini Casserole

Leftover turkey never tasted this good.

Ingredients:

  • 2 cups cooked turkey, shredded
  • 8 ounces spaghetti, cooked
  • 1 can cream of mushroom soup
  • 1 cup chicken broth
  • 1 cup grated parmesan cheese
  • Salt and pepper to taste

Process:

  1. Preheat oven to 350°F (175°C).
  2. Combine turkey, spaghetti, soup, and broth in a bowl; transfer to a baking dish.
  3. Top with parmesan and bake for 25 minutes.

Make it Unique:
Add assorted veggies or use chicken instead of turkey.

9. Macaroni and Cheese Casserole

The ultimate comfort food, holiday-style.

Ingredients:

  • 2 cups elbow macaroni, cooked
  • 2 cups shredded cheddar cheese
  • 1 cup milk
  • ¼ cup butter
  • 1 egg, beaten
  • Salt and pepper to taste

Process:

  1. Preheat oven to 350°F (175°C).
  2. Mix all ingredients in a large bowl; transfer to a greased baking dish.
  3. Bake for 30 minutes until golden and bubbly.

Make it Unique:
Mix in cooked bacon or add breadcrumbs on top for extra crunch.

10. Broccoli Cheese Casserole

A delightful way to sneak in some greens.

Ingredients:

  • 4 cups broccoli florets
  • 2 cups shredded cheddar cheese
  • 1 cup cream of mushroom soup
  • 1 cup cooked rice
  • 1 cup breadcrumbs
  • Salt and pepper to taste

Process:

  1. Preheat oven to 350°F (175°C).
  2. Combine broccoli, cheese, soup, and rice in a bowl; transfer to a greased baking dish.
  3. Top with breadcrumbs and bake for 30 minutes.

Make it Unique:
Add chopped red peppers or substitute rice with quinoa.

11. Italian Sausage and Peppers Casserole

A hearty dish full of Italian flavors.

Ingredients:

  • 1 pound Italian sausage, sliced
  • 2 bell peppers, sliced
  • 1 onion, sliced
  • 1 can diced tomatoes
  • 1 teaspoon Italian seasoning
  • Salt and pepper to taste

Process:

  1. Preheat oven to 375°F (190°C).
  2. Brown sausage in a pan; add peppers and onions until soft.
  3. Stir in tomatoes and seasonings; transfer to a baking dish and bake for 30 minutes.

Make it Unique:
Serve over pasta or add olives for an extra kick.

12. Creamy Mushroom and Wild Rice Casserole

A cozy dish that warms the soul.

Ingredients:

  • 1 cup wild rice, cooked
  • 1 can cream of mushroom soup
  • 1 cup mushrooms, sliced
  • 1 cup vegetable broth
  • 1 cup grated cheese
  • Salt and pepper to taste

Process:

  1. Preheat oven to 350°F (175°C).
  2. Mix all ingredients in a bowl and pour into a greased baking dish.
  3. Bake for 30 minutes until bubbly and golden.

Make it Unique:
Substitute wild rice with brown rice or add spinach for more nutrients.

13. Cranberry and Sausage Stuffing Casserole

A flavorful twist on a holiday classic.

Ingredients:

  • 1 pound sausage, cooked and crumbled
  • 4 cups stuffing mix
  • 1 cup cranberries (fresh or dried)
  • 2 cups chicken broth
  • 1 teaspoon sage
  • Salt and pepper to taste

Process:

  1. Preheat oven to 350°F (175°C).
  2. Combine sausage, stuffing, cranberries, broth, and seasonings in a bowl.
  3. Transfer to a baking dish and bake for 30 minutes until golden.

Make it Unique:
Add nuts for crunch or use different kinds of bread for the stuffing.


These festive Christmas casserole recipes are designed to bring joy and satisfaction to your holiday gatherings. Whether you try one or all, you’re sure to create cherished memories around the table. Happy cooking and enjoy every delicious bite!

Recent Posts